![]() |
|
Resettare il campo ID contatore in un db Ms Access
Sappiamo che il campo di tipo contatore di un qualsiasi database continua a crescere con l'aumentare dei record e non segue una numerazione perfettamente continua se viene cancellato un record. Se ad esempio abbiamo 1 - Pippo 2 - Pluto 3 - Paperinoe cancelliamo Pluto, avremo 1 - Pippo 3 - Paperinoe l'ID 2 andrā perso. E' frequente che in fase di test, per qualsiasi applicazione, si aggiungano ad una tabella dati di prova, ed una volta messo in produzione il database, ci si trova col contatore che parte, ad esempio, da 38! Per me che sono un perfezionista a livelli quasi paranoici, una cosa del genere č fastidiosissima! Par azzerare il campo contatore potete cancellare il campo (ad esempio...) ID dalla tabella aperta in visualizzazione struttura, salvare le modifiche alla tabella (vi consiglio di chiudere e di riaprire il file .mdb) e creare di nuovo il campo (ad esempio...) ID assegnandogli il tipo di dato contatore. Non č un teorema nč un procedimento particolarmente ortodosso... provate!!! Due consigli: 1. Copiate ed incollate il database prima di effettuare dette operazioni, al fine di non perdere dati se il database ne contiene giā, in caso di manovra sbagliata per una distrazione. 2. Se avete delle tabelle relazionate con dei dati giā presenti, occhio a non perdere le relazioni se sono state implementate attraverso in o i capi ID: modificate i valori a mano se necessario. |
IN EVIDENZA
Una slidegallery con jQuery
Pagamenti online con PayPal e PHP
Breve guida a jQuery
Effetto ombra su testo con Photoshop
Guadagna col tuo sito grazie a TradeD...
Guida XHTML
Riscrivere le URL con Asp
Riavviare IIS
HTTP 500 internal server error
Generare password casuali in Javascri...
Errore 80004005: Cannot update. Datab...
Introduzione ad Ajax ed Asp con Jscri...
Referenze dei Tag Html
Stringhe di connessione via ODBC e Ol...
Referenze dei fogli di stile Css
Le espressioni regolari in Javascript
|
||||
© 2001/2010 lukeonweb.net - A cura di Luca Ruggiero, Partita IVA 05564851219 -
Privacy |
Pubblicitā |
Contatti
| |||||